What Is Drug Deception?
Understanding the Context
“Drug deception” describes misleading practices within drug development, particularly the manipulation or suppression of clinical trial data. These may include altering results, withholding adverse event reports, or designing trials to favor a drug’s effectiveness. Such actions undermine patient safety, erode public trust, and compromise the integrity of medical science.

Why Drug Transparency Matters Now More Than Ever
The pharmaceutical landscape is evolving, driven by growing demand for open science and real-world evidence. But systemic issues persist: lack of data sharing, slow regulatory response, and insufficient whistleblower protections leave patients vulnerable. Transparency isn’t merely about compliance—it’s about accountability and restoring faith in medicine.
Global organizations, patient advocates, and lawmakers are beginning to respond, pushing for stricter reporting standards, mandatory data sharing, and robust safeguards for whistleblowers. However, true change requires not just policy reform but a cultural shift toward openness.
